Time between defecation?  I have a question in regards to time between bloods defecating. I’ve read many things saying that it is not unusual for a blood to go several months before defecating, even cases of up to 6 months. The last time Carnage defecated (not urates) was around the end of January. He has eaten weekly since then and has not defecated. He urates between every meal since he has moved onto rats, sometimes more then once. He seems perfectly health in every way, has great sheds, very friendly, and ideal husbandry. He is growing like crazy, and putting on girth and length. So is it safe to assume that he is metabolizing his meals and using the majority of nutrients towards growth? I’m sure everything is fine I just want to double check with anyone who has had the experience.

Time between defecation?  Mikey, I’m not exactly sure exactly why they retain their stool for so long. Although bloods do have slow metabolism, so like you I’m thinking that retaining their stool for so long gives them maximal time to absorb nutrients and whatnot. Marle last gave me a full bowl movement on December 30th of 2008. Ever since then its been small amounts of urine, maybe a few urates now and then. I know it doesn’t seem right that an animal could/would hold for that long but damned if they don’t. Just give it time and keep him well hydrated and he’ll eventually do it.
